im having a bit of bother with multi tasking , but on the bmx, i try really hard to get big airs, and i can achieve that, but then i can also do "no footers" but when i do them i dont get as much height, when i try and get a big air and throw in a no footer i alwyas end up pulling the trick too late and falling or not doing the trick at all and wrecking the landing, any tips on how to get big airs and do a trick (or no footer) at the same time,

just go like you would get big air and do a no footer or hop off the lip and then do it.
I used to do the same thing with X-ups when i learned them, i would do them very late in the air.
You just have to concentrate on throwing your feet off before you are at your peak...
It will take time, the only thing that can save you is having a comfy seat(so your balls, if they have dropped, dont hurt when you miss your pedals). Haha.
